Transaction 7e9751568830a7ce5e0f6e8842595ca314fb50493167932d2b57b5b4d32e920f

block
3d0deb22a31157a584313d4d4769e48b4a0c51b7c914134fec70a2ee5193b553

1 Input

23 Outputs